Output 9500b33abdddcd5fadc689f08fa1350f399b5977d7029a527540b45073caa4ed:1

value
751244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815511143231926e58ff9f8a8fc450ba4242405c OP_EQUAL
address
3DUrzq2PHjYsniWCEMPQNfMkkv1VNJ6HNi
transaction
9500b33abdddcd5fadc689f08fa1350f399b5977d7029a527540b45073caa4ed
confirmations
261066
spent
true